Rich maroons, royal blues, festive yellows, and vibrant pinks create instant ambiance and resonate with the warmth of Indian tradition. Layer patterns and textures—a kantha-stitched bedspread, silk or cotton throws, embroidered cushion covers, and airy sheer curtains—all evoke the multi-sensory charm of home. Source your linens and textiles from local artisans or trusted online marketplaces to support craftsmanship and ensure authenticity (Textiles in India - Ministry of Textiles).Lighting is a game-changer: mix and match brass oil lamps, fairy lights, intricately designed pendant lamps, or stained-glass sconces. Not only do these set a cozy, inviting mood, but accent lighting highlights colorful wall art and decor, letting your personality shine.Blending Tradition with Modern Indian Girl Room DesignCelebrate heritage while embracing contemporary aesthetics. Traditional wall hangings, hand-painted mandalas, or block print tapestries serve as bold statements. Antique wooden picture frames filled with family photos, terracotta pots, or even upcycled jewelry stands offer nostalgia with a twist. For a dash of glamour, gold-finished mirrors or decorative trays add the kind of sparkle that’s synonymous with Indian decor.Function must meet flair: invest in ottomans and window benches with hidden storage, floating bookshelves, and nestable tables. These transform even the smallest room into a versatile, organized retreat—critical for urban apartments or dorm living (National Association of Home Builders).Space Optimization Strategies for Small Indian RoomsSmart design is all about squeezing the most from your square footage. Choose multipurpose furniture—beds with drawer storage, foldable desks for study, stackable stools, and slim profile wardrobes. For walls, pick lighter neutrals for the main areas and designate one accent wall in deep magenta, peacock blue, or turmeric yellow for a burst of color without overpowering the space. Wall decals with paisley or lotus motifs provide easy, renter-friendly visual interest.Add greenery with low-maintenance plants like pothos, snake plant, or aloe—these thrive with little care and contribute to better indoor air quality. Decorative planters in hand-painted ceramics or metallic finishes tie in the Indian aesthetic while grounding your space in nature. Mix geometric prints with florals, combine classic block-prints with minimalist shelving, or pair a traditional swing chair with modern poufs. The juxtaposition creates visual interest and relatability.Tips 3: Leverage Smart LightingLayer lighting—combine desk lamps for task lighting, wall sconces for ambiance, and fairy lights for that magical glow. Consider smart bulbs programmable via phone apps for effortless customization and energy savings.Tips 4: Turn Challenges into Creative OpportunitiesLimited square footage? Use corner shelves and wall hooks. Rental restrictions? Try peel-and-stick wallpapers and reusable décor. Tight budget? Embrace DIY culture—upcycle old dupattas into curtains or reframe classic saree borders as wall art.FAQQ: What key elements define an Indian-inspired girl’s room?
